8 Days to The Stanbic Yetu Festival, 90% Of Tickets Off The Shelf

With only 8 days remaining for the much-awaited and much-hyped Stanbic Yetu Festival, the tickets are almost running out with 90 percent of them having been sold out. Stanbic Bank and Radio Africa Events have promised customers and fans an experience to always behold and remember.

The festival is in line with the Stanbic brand’s aspirations to give Kenyans a unique, unforgettable, and authentic live music experience that will leave a lasting impression. It is also part of the brand’s long-lasting legacy of supporting and growing talents within and without the country.

This year’s festival is set to hit with a high level of rejuvenated energy as compared to the one held the previous year as it is set to bring into the country Boyz II Men – one of the most iconic R&B groups in the music industry’s history.

Those who have been around for “some time” will tell you that the group has redefined popular music and continues to create timeless hits that appeal to fans across all generations having penned and performed some of the most celebrated and best-known classics of the past two decades.

Closer home, multi-award-winning band Sauti Sol will be part of the amazing talents lined up for a fire performance. The Afro-pop band of the Sura Yako fame will entertain fans with an array of music from their 5 albums and 1 EP, which were well-received locally and worldwide.

What is more, renowned DJs such as DJ Shaky, G-Money, DJ Grauchi, DJ Dream, CNG and DJ Forest will be in the house to spin some of the magical tunes that will only be told to future generations through books and folktales.

The festival is set to take place on June 10, 2023, at Uhuru Gardens.
